Flood Watch
Issued: 9:44 PM Sep. 12, 2026 – National Weather Service
...FLOOD WATCH IN EFFECT FROM SUNDAY MORNING THROUGH SUNDAY AFTERNOON... * WHAT...Flooding caused by excessive rainfall continues to be possible. * WHERE...A portion of southern Connecticut, including the following area, Northern New Haven. * WHEN...From Sunday morning through Sunday afternoon. * IMPACTS...Excessive runoff may result in flooding of rivers, creeks, streams, and other low-lying and flood-prone locations. * ADDITIONAL DETAILS... - Showers with heavy downpours and a few thunderstorms early Sunday morning into midday Sunday may lead to flooding. Average rainfall amounts are forecast to range from 1.5 to 3 inches with locally higher amounts up around 5 inches possible. Peak hourly rates could reach 1.5 to 2.5 inches. - http://www.weather.gov/safety/flood PRECAUTIONARY/PREPAREDNESS ACTIONS... You should monitor later forecasts and be alert for possible Flood Warnings. Those living in areas prone to flooding should be prepared to take action should flooding develop. &&
